Why Use Castile Soap for Washing Dishes?

Castile soap is a great alternative to conventional dishwashing detergents that contain harmful chemicals such as phosphates, chlorine, and synthetic fragrances. These chemicals can be harsh on the skin and the environment. Castile soap, on the other hand, is biodegradable, non-toxic, and safe for septic systems. It is also gentle on your hands and does not leave behind any residue on your dishes.

How to Use Castile Soap for Washing Dishes

Step 1: Pre-rinse your dishes

Before washing your dishes with castile soap, it is important to pre-rinse them with warm water to remove any loose food particles and grease. This will make the cleaning process easier and more effective.

Step 2: Dilute the castile soap

Castile soap is highly concentrated, so it is important to dilute it before using it to wash dishes. Mix one part castile soap with three parts warm water in a bowl or a sink. You can also add a few drops of essential oils such as lemon or lavender for a refreshing scent.

Step 3: Wash your dishes

Dip a sponge or a dishcloth into the diluted castile soap mixture and use it to wash your dishes. Scrub the dishes gently, paying close attention to any stubborn stains or food residues. Rinse the dishes with warm water to remove any soap residue.

Step 4: Dry your dishes

After washing your dishes, use a clean towel or a dish rack to dry them. Avoid using paper towels as they can be wasteful and harmful to the environment.

Tips and Tricks for Washing Dishes with Castile Soap

Tip 1: Use a Soap Dispenser

Instead of diluting the castile soap in a bowl or a sink, you can use a soap dispenser to make the process easier and more convenient. Fill the dispenser with diluted castile soap and use it to wash your dishes.

Tip 2: Soak Your Dishes

If you have dishes with stubborn stains or food residues, you can soak them in a mixture of diluted castile soap and warm water for a few minutes before washing them. This will help to loosen the dirt and make it easier to clean.

Tip 3: Use a Scrubber Brush

If you have dishes with tough stains or burnt-on food, you can use a scrubber brush to remove them. Be careful not to use a brush with abrasive bristles that can scratch your dishes.

Tip 4: Rinse Your Dishes Thoroughly

After washing your dishes with castile soap, make sure to rinse them thoroughly with warm water to remove any soap residue. This will ensure that your dishes are clean and free from any soap taste or smell.
